El txakoli es un vino blanco elaborado con uvas verdes autóctonas que se ha elaborado en el País Vasco mucho antes del siglo XVI. El terreno que rodea la localidad costera de Getaria da nombre a la Denominación de Origen “Txakoli de Getaria”, la mejor y más exclusiva.
Conoce los pueblos pesqueros de Getaria y Zarautz y descubre todos los secretos de este vino característico en un txakolindegi (casa de txakoli, en euskera) junto a un aperitivo local que comprende productos típicos del mar Cantábrico. ¡Vive una experiencia única con nosotros!

Txakoli wine has been crafted around Getaria since before the 16th century, making it one of Europe’s oldest appellations.
Local winemakers employ sustainable vineyard practices to protect coastal soils and maintain the region’s biodiversity.
